什么是Java条件表达式
Java条件表达式是一个条件语句,用于在程序中根据条件执行不同的代码块。它通常由一个布尔表达式和在满足条件时执行的代码组成,也可以加上一个else语句,处理不满足条件时的情况。条件表达式用于控制程序流程,实现更加灵活多变的逻辑控制,提高代码的效率和可读性。
Java条件表达式的语法
Java条件表达式通常采用三目运算符的方式表现,语法如下:
boolean expression ? expression1 : expression2
其中,boolean expression是一个布尔表达式,expression1和expression2则是两种可执行的代码块。如果boolean expression的值是true,那么执行expression1,否则执行expression2。可以在复杂的条件表达式中使用括号来控制执行的先后顺序。
Java条件表达式的使用示例
下面是一个Java条件表达式的使用示例:
public class TestConditionalExpression { public static void main(String[] args) { int a = 10; int b = 5; int max = (a > b) ? a : b; System.out.println("Max value is " + max); } }
在这个示例中,我们使用了Java条件表达式来判断a和b的大小,并将大的值赋值给max变量,最后通过System.out.println()方法输出max的值。当条件a > b成立时,max的值就是a;当条件不成立时,max的值就是b。这样,我们就可以通过Java条件表达式实现一个更加简洁和可读性更好的逻辑判断。
总之,Java条件表达式是Java语言重要的控制结构之一,它能够根据不同的条件执行不同的代码块,实现更加灵活和高效的逻辑控制。在日常的开发中,我们可以灵活地运用Java条件表达式来提高代码的效率和可读性。
本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/javapeixun5p-2.html
郑重声明:
本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。
我们不承担任何技术及版权问题,且不对任何资源负法律责任。
如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。
如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!